Summary/Abstract: The text represents interactive approaches and exercises used in the Bulgarian language teacher’s practice for the fifth grade - preparation and execution of a debate, preparation and presentation of projects, work in groups, placing the student in the role of a proof-reader and etc. Concrete examples are being given for the use of interactive approaches during the classes. The concept that this method of teaching provokes theinterest of children is being expressed, as well as the fact that it awakens their emotionality,helps for the implementation of connections between subjects and as a whole raises the efficiency of Bulgarian language lessons.
